Adaptive Cleaning
The majority of robot vacuums allow you to modify the cleaning functions based on the type of floor and its the condition. You can, for example, set the vacuum to use an appropriate suction level for different types of flooring. You can also prioritize areas with a lot of dirt or debris like corners and stairs. Some models also allow you to switch between carpets and hard floors. Some models even have spots that allow you to clean a particular area.
In addition to being able to adjust to different flooring types and types of flooring, the top robot vacuums are intelligent enough to stay clear of obstacles that might hinder the cleaning process. You can create an inventory of "no-go" zones and they'll use smart sensors to navigate around furniture. Certain models are also able to detect the fact that they've cleaned an area, which helps prevent them from running over the same spots repeatedly.
Most robot vacuum cleaners can be controlled using a remote control or smartphone app, or smart speakers such as Amazon Alexa or Google Assistant. Certain models can be programmed to clean according to the schedule, so you can set them to work while you are away. If you prefer to avoid relying on mobile devices, opt for one with a built-in camera which can display and create the map of a room.
Certain models allow you to review the previous sessions to see what areas were cleaned and the time that was spent on them. These features can be especially useful in particularly dirty space that requires extra attention.

Virtual Boundaries
When robot vacuums first began taking off, they relied on random patterns and basic sensors to navigate their homes. They bounded around like pinballs lost in confusion, often hitting objects and using up energy for unnecessary cleaning. This changed thanks to the advent of mapping technology, which enabled them to digitally record a home's layout and plan efficient cleaning routes. It also increased efficiency and extended battery life.
There are privacy concerns when using a best robot vacuum and mop vacuum cleaner, despite the benefits. For one the vacuum's GPS and navigation systems can track the floor of a house and reveal details about the location of the owner and income level, as well as other data points. This information can be used for advertising and marketing purposes, and can even reveal private information if a hacker gets access to the information.
One way to limit the usage of your robot vacuum's map is to create virtual boundaries. These prevent the machine from entering areas where it shouldn't be, such as bedrooms when your children are sleeping or an office in which you're holding an online meeting. You can establish these boundaries by making use of a smartphone app and they will be in effect during a cleaning cycle.
Another option is to use barriers that are physical, but it could be unattractive or cause a trip hazard. This kind of barrier could also hinder the mapping by blocking sensors and causing it to be difficult for the vacuum to detect furniture.
An alternative to consider is an alternative is the Dreame Smart Mapping system, which makes use of Lidar and 3D ToF imaging to produce highly precise maps of your home and identify furniture. The robot then moves precisely around furniture, avoiding contact to ensure a thorough cleaning. To ensure maximum performance, it's important to regularly update your maps and keep the sensors clean to prevent the buildup of debris. Also, be sure to check and clean the charging contacts to ensure that there is a secure connection between the dock and the robot. This will help keep the robot in good condition and ensure that it can return to its base when needed.
Auto-Emptying
If you buy a robot vacuum cleaner that has automatic emptying capabilities, you will be able to enjoy hands-free cleaning and not have empty its trash bin manually. This feature is particularly useful for those who use their robots frequently and require the convenience of smaller amounts of emptying.
The majority of robotic vacuums have small dustbins that you have to clear out every couple of cleaning sessions, but self-emptying models have larger bases that automatically dump dirt that has been collected into their own docking stations. This means you don't have to clean the device's trash bin and brings the dream of a fully automated household one step closer to becoming a reality.
Robots with this feature usually have docking stations that can hold a week's worth of debris, depending on the maker. By using a sealed transfer method they can dump their contents into the station and continue to run until it's time to return to base for a new bin.
These stations not only simplify the process of emptying a robot but they can also reduce the exposure to harmful allergens. During the transfer process, advanced filtering ensures that harmful substances do not return to your home and are disposed of in the device’s internal dustbin. Furthermore, the huge capacity of these ports could minimize how often you need to open and close the dustbin, making them ideal for those suffering from allergies.
In addition to the automatic vacuum and mop robot pouring of debris into their bases, a lot of these products come with built-in sensors that notify you when they're nearly empty. Some models have an easy switch that can be turned off and on, whereas others provide more specific information such as an icon or status. Self-Navigation
Designed for hands-free operation, robotic vacuum cleaners utilize motors and sensors to facilitate floor cleaning with minimal input. These disk-shaped machines travel throughout the house by mapping rooms and spaces and create virtual barriers to prevent furniture and objects, and return to docking stations when the battery has run out or the task is completed.
Robotic vacuums, also referred to as robovacs, or robomops have made significant advancements in recent years. Today's top performers are able to remove fine particles, like baking soda and sand and heavy debris, including metal screws and nuts. They can also take on pet hair and other soft debris.
Certain models come with mopping features that use an elongated cloth or pad to apply constant pressure and eliminate stubborn stains. Advanced mapping systems, like ECOVACS' TrueMapping 2.0 and AIVI 3D technology, help robots overcome obstacles in real-time and navigate efficiently.
While a robovac isn't able to tackle the stairs or clean dirt from the ground as well as manual vacuums, the modern models can do a good robot vacuum job at maneuvering around corners and narrow spaces. They make use of a combination of sensors and cameras to generate digital maps of the room as well as detect walls and objects and design efficient cleaning routes. They can also make use of a recognition algorithm for a variety household items, and learn from previous mistakes to improve navigation in the future.
Many robotic vacuums also have a built-in rechargeable battery for long-lasting operation. Some robovacs offer Wi-Fi connectivity so they can connect to your home's wireless network and receive updates to software automatically. Some robovacs are compatible with voice assistants. This allows you to control them using your smartphone or other smart device.
Aside from emptying the dustbin regularly robots need minimal maintenance. However, it is important to ensure their brushes are free of hair that has become tangled and to clean their cameras or sensors regularly to ensure proper performance. Also, you should make sure to set your robot up on an agenda and to empty the dustbin before each use to maximize performance.
